1 EXHIBIT 4.4 SECOND AMENDMENT TO CREDIT AGREEMENT THIS SECOND AMENDMENT TO CREDIT AGREEMENT (this "Second Amendment"), dated as of March 24, 1998 but effective as of October 1, 1997, is entered into among GAYLORD ENTERTAINMENT COMPANY, a Delaware corporation ("Borrower"), the banks listed on the signature pages hereof (collectively, "Lenders"), and NATIONSBANK OF TEXAS, N.A., as Administrative Lender (in said capacity, "Administrative Lender"). BACKGROUND A. Borrower, Lenders and Administrative Lender are parties to that certain Credit Agreement, dated as of August 19, 1997, as amended by that certain First Amendment to Credit Agreement, dated as of September 30, 1997 (said Credit Agreement, as amended, the "Credit Agreement"; the terms defined in the Credit Agreement and not otherwise defined herein shall be used herein as defined in the Credit Agreement). B. Borrower, Lenders and Administrative Lender desire to make an amendment to the Credit Agreement. NOW, THEREFORE, in consideration of the covenants, conditions and agreements hereinafter set forth, and for other good and valuable consideration, the receipt and adequacy of which are all hereby acknowledged, Borrower, Lenders and Administrative Lender covenant and agree as follows: 1. AMENDMENTS TO CREDIT AGREEMENT. (a) The definition of "EBITDA" set forth in Article I of the Credit Agreement is hereby amended to read as follows: "`EBITDA' means, for the Companies, on a consolidated basis, for the twelve (12) month period preceding any date of determination, the sum of (a) operating income plus (b) depreciation expense, plus (c) amortization expense (not including amortization expense related to program rights and inventories), plus (d) to the extent not already included in operating income, the lesser of (i) earnings or (ii) cash distributions received from unconsolidated Subsidiaries, plus (e) for any period beginning January 1, 1998, to the extent included in determining operating income, but without duplication with respect to any non-cash charges set forth in the immediately succeeding proviso, non-recurring, non-cash charges, if any, minus (f) for any period beginning January 1, 1998, to the extent included in determining operating income, non-recurring, non-cash credits, if any; provided, however, for purposes of calculation of EBITDA for any period of determination including the month of (y) September, 1997, there shall be added to EBITDA (to the extent included in determining operating income) the sum of cash and 2 non-cash charges related to (A) the Westinghouse Merger not to exceed $36,300,000, plus (B) the write-down of television program inventories at KTVT not to exceed $11,740,000, and (z) December, 1997, there shall be added to EBITDA (to the extent included in determining operating income) the sum of cash and non-cash charges related to (A) the write-down of property, equipment and inventory and for severance and termination benefits related to the closing of the Opryland theme park not to exceed $42,006,000, plus (B) the cessation of operations of CMT Europe not to exceed $5,000,000." (b) Section 4.4 of the Credit Agreement is hereby amended to read as follows: "4.4 Net Worth. Borrower shall not permit Net Worth (a) as of October 1, 1997 (taking into account the effect of the Westinghouse Merger) and thereafter up to but not including December 31, 1997 to be less than an amount equal to the sum of (i) the greater of 90% of Net Worth on October 1, 1997 (taking into account the effect of the Westinghouse Merger) or $425,000,000, plus (ii) 50% of the cumulative Net Income from and including October 1, 1997 through the date of calculation (but excluding from the calculation of cumulative Net Income the effect, if any, of any fiscal quarter (or any portion of a fiscal quarter not yet ended) for which Net Income was a negative number), plus (iii) 75% of the Net Proceeds received by Borrower or any of its Subsidiaries from any Equity Issuance occurring on and after October 1, 1997 up to but not including December 31, 1997, plus (iv) any increase in stockholders' equity of Borrower pursuant to the conversion or exchange of preferred Capital Stock of Borrower into common Capital Stock of Borrower, plus (v) an amount equal to 75% of the net worth of any Person that becomes a Subsidiary of Borrower or substantially all of the assets of which are acquired by Borrower or any of its Subsidiaries to the extent the purchase price therefor is paid in Capital Stock of Borrower or any of its Subsidiaries, and (b) as of December 31, 1997 and thereafter to be less than an amount equal to the sum of (i) 90% of Net Worth on December 31, 1997, plus (ii) 50% of the cumulative Net Income from and including January 1, 1998 (but excluding from the calculation of cumulative Net Income the effect, if any, of any fiscal quarter (or any portion of a fiscal quarter not yet ended) for which Net Income was a negative number), plus (iii) 75% of the Net Proceeds received by Borrower or any of its Subsidiaries from any Equity Issuance occurring on and after January 1, 1998, plus (iv) any increase in stockholders' equity of Borrower pursuant to the conversion or exchange of preferred Capital Stock of Borrower into common Capital Stock of Borrower, plus (v) an amount equal to 75% of the net worth of any Person that becomes a Subsidiary of Borrower or substantially all of the assets of which are acquired by Borrower or any of its Subsidiaries to the extent the purchase price therefor is paid in Capital Stock of Borrower or any of its Subsidiaries."
